msfconsole上传文件
时间: 2023-10-09 13:09:40 浏览: 210
在 Metasploit Framework 中,你可以使用 `upload` 命令来上传文件到目标系统。以下是上传文件的步骤:
1. 打开 msfconsole 并连接到目标系统。
2. 使用 `search` 命令查找适合你的漏洞利用模块。
3. 选择一个合适的模块并设置必要的选项,例如目标 IP、端口、Payload 等等。
4. 在 Meterpreter shell 中使用 `upload` 命令上传文件。例如:`upload /path/to/file /remote/path/to/file`。
在上传文件时,你需要注意以下几点:
- 确保你拥有足够的权限来上传文件。
- 确保上传的文件名和路径是正确的。
- 确保上传的文件不会被杀毒软件或防火墙拦截。
如果你需要上传多个文件,你可以使用 `upload_directory` 命令来上传整个文件夹。例如:`upload_directory /path/to/directory /remote/path/to/directory`。
相关问题
使用msfconsole
Metasploit Framework (MSF) 是一款强大的网络安全漏洞检测和利用平台,提供了一系列用于渗透测试、漏洞扫描和exploitation的功能。MSFConsole 是 Metasploit 的图形化控制台界面,通过这个交互式工具,你可以:
1. **加载模块**:可以从 Metasploit 的大量内置模块库中加载和管理,包括漏洞探测、权限提升、信息收集等不同类型的模块。
2. **目标扫描**:扫描网络范围内的主机寻找可利用的安全漏洞,比如端口扫描、指纹识别等。
3. **利用执行**:一旦找到目标,你可以选择合适的exploit模块对漏洞进行利用,生成payload并执行。
4. **Meterpreter shell**:获得shell后,可以通过Meterpreter shell进行进一步的操作,如文件上传、修改系统配置、数据提取等。
5. **监听和管理会话**:MSFConsole可以帮助你监控和管理当前的会话活动,包括查看已建立的会话、终止会话等。
6. **定制任务**:可以创建自定义任务脚本,自动化整个渗透过程。
7. **学习和研究**:MSF还包含大量的教程和文档,适合初学者学习和专业人员进行深入研究。
如何在metasploit用php上传文件
在Metasploit中,可以使用以下命令来上传文件:
1. 打开msfconsole并启动一个后门会话。
2. 使用以下命令将文件上传到目标计算机:
```
upload /path/to/local/file.ext /path/to/remote/directory/
```
3. 如果上传成功,您将看到以下消息:
```
[*] uploaded /path/to/local/file.ext to /path/to/remote/directory/
```
请注意,如果目标计算机上没有写入权限,上传可能会失败。您还可以使用其他模块,如exploit/multi/http/phpmyadmin_server,来上传文件。
阅读全文